This Morning viewers slate TV show for giving shoplifter airtime

This Morning viewers have criticised the show for allowing a former shoplifter who stole millions of pounds worth of products to appear on the programme.

Fans of the show felt Kim Farry shouldn’t have been allowed on air, calling her an ‘attention seeker’.

One wrote: “Why is this thief on tv and not in prison?”

Another tweeted: "Are they paying this thief to be talking about stealing as a career #ThisMorning?"

"Why the hell is @thismorning giving airtime again to the millionaire shoplifter? She’s a criminal! Plenty of people are poor but don’t steal. Stop making these people celebs," posted a third.

Farry went on to reveal she’s published a book about her previous life as thief.

"I've written a book and it might be turned into a screenplay," she said. "We're just waiting on publishers at the moment.

"I can't get my head around it. If it was to, I'd like Sheridan Smith or Michelle Keegan to play me.

"If that comes off then I'll have enough money to set up my own business."

The self-described shop-lifting queen also admitted she has struggled to get a job due to her notoriety.

"Having to live on benefits is terrible, it's made me realise how tough it is.

"I've tried to get a job but now I've exposed myself it's even worse," she commented.
